The most popular folding treadmill frame design is the fold-on-pin (FOP) design, in which the deck of the running belt is raised to connect with the console mast. Some treadmills use a hinge system with multiple links to create a stronger folding mechanism. This allows the treadmill's motion to be similar to that of the garage door. It is also easier to open and close. During testing T3 fitness experts evaluated the quality of construction of each treadmill that folds as well as its performance while running or exercising. A quality treadmill will come with an emergency key that you can attach to your clothing while you use the machine. If you lose your balance and fall off the treadmill, this key will stop the belt to prevent injuries. Certain models come with cooling fans to keep you cool, as well as an area to store your valuables. Comparing folding treadmills to non-folding models, folding models are safer and more portable. They are generally designed so that the deck folds upwards between two hand rails, which helps to reduce the space it occupies in the room. Most folding treadmills also include transport wheels, which allow users to easily move them when they are not in use. For safety reasons however, they should never be placed against a wall or piece of furniture, because it could fall down and cause injury. When looking for a folding treadmill be sure to verify its maximum user weight and top speed. Also, you should be sure that the motor is strong enough to meet your needs, as a powerful motor will provide a smoother and more comfortable exercise. Another factor to consider is the dimensions of the running deck, which must be at least 1.75 meters long and 0.4 metres wide. You do not want your run to be difficult due to the fact that the treadmill is too small. Also, fold treadmill must consider the incline of your treadmill, since a higher inclined treadmill will intensify the intensity of your exercise.
